Expectations for Democracy within the Arab World

From July 26, 2010 until September 21, 2010

On September 21st, Casa Árabe hosts the conference Expectations for Democracy within the Arab World by Khair El Din Hasib, Director General of the Centre for Arab Unity Studies in Beirut.

A native of Iraq, Hasib holds a MS in Economics from the London School of Economics and a PhD from Cambridge University in the United Kingdom. He has served and developed an important role in various organizations which promote democracy and Human Rights, such as the National Arab Congress, Arab Organization on Human Rights and the Anti-Corruption Arab Organization.

Gema Martín Muñoz, Casa Árabe’s General Director, will introduce the Tribune which will take place at the institution’s auditorium in Madrid.
